Google AI Studio 2.0
Google AI Studio 2.0

Full-stack vibe coding powered by Antigravity + Firebase

223 upvotes🤖 AI AssistantsMar 2026

Google AI Studio 2.0 revolutionizes full-stack development by offering a seamless, AI-powered vibe coding environment accessible directly through the browser. Leveraging Antigravity technology, it enables users to transform simple prompts into fully functional, production-ready applications with minimal effort. Its integrated Firebase support provides easy database and authentication setup, while multiplayer features facilitate collaborative development. The smarter agent assists with multi-step tasks, project memory, and auto-fixing errors, streamlining the entire coding process. Designed for developers, startups, and AI enthusiasts, this platform simplifies complex workflows and accelerates app deployment, making full-stack development more accessible and efficient. Its comprehensive feature set—covering multi-file management, npm package integration, and deployment to Cloud Run—sets it apart from traditional coding environments, empowering users to go from concept to deployment effortlessly.

OpenClaw
OpenClaw

The AI that actually does things

819 upvotes🤖 AI AssistantsJan 2026

OpenClaw is an innovative AI-powered personal agent that transforms your computer into a 24/7 automation hub, accessible from popular chat platforms like WhatsApp and Telegram. Building on its predecessors Moltbot and Clawbot, OpenClaw offers extensive control over your system, enabling users to execute shell commands, manage files, control browsers, and automate workflows seamlessly. Its persistent memory and full system access make it a powerful tool for developers, tech enthusiasts, and productivity-focused individuals seeking a highly customizable automation experience. What sets OpenClaw apart is its open-source foundation, over 50 integrations, and emphasis on privacy by operating locally on your machine, ensuring sensitive data remains secure. Its versatility and ease of access make it an attractive solution for those looking to enhance productivity, streamline repetitive tasks, or build complex automation pipelines using familiar chat interfaces.
